France makes digital progress

Over nine out of 10 French households were equipped to receive digital TV at the end of 2010, according to figures released by regulator the CSA.

Only 6.1% of French households in French regions set for digital switchover this year still receive analogue TV services. In regions that achieved terrestrial digital switchover last year, meanwhile, four out of five second sets in homes are now equipped to receive digital signals.

Some 60.2% of households have chosen to receive DTT signals, up 11.9% year-on-year.
